Adrien Brody: The Man, The Actor
Before we talk about the money, let's appreciate the man and his work. Adrien Brody was born on April 14, 1973, in New York City. He started his acting career in the late 1980s, but it was his breakthrough role in Roman Polanski's "The Pianist" (2002) that truly catapulted him into the limelight. Brody won the Academy Award for Best Actor for his portrayal of Wladyslaw Szpilman, becoming the youngest actor to win in that category at just 29 years old.
